Odaily Planet Daily News: Japan's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ry (METI) announced a new initiative to increase mainstream adoption of digital public goods by businesses and consumers in line with Japan's digitalization plan. The initiative, called "Demonstration Project for Building Digital Public Goods Using Web 3.0 and Blockchain," aims to develop novel practical cases for blockchain in Japan. Led by METI, the initiative has attracted several industry leaders including PwC, Rakuten, and NTT Digital to join the pilot study. (Coingeek)
